Lot Description

[EARLY PHOTOGRAPHY]. 10 assorted portraits housed in frames including Very Rare Union examples.

Sixth plate daguerreotype portrait of a woman wearing a tall bonnet, gold-highlighted jewelry, and a plaid dress. A vase of intricately hand-tinted flowers rests atop the table next to her. (Significant tarnishing, some fading, spotting.) Housed in a wooden frame under a bejeweled mat. -- Half plate tintype portrait of a woman sitting in a fringed studio chair. (Minor spotting.) Housed in a Very Rare Union frame, Branches of Leaves and Flowers [Berg 7-12] (soiling, surface wear). -- Cabinet card portrait of a woman housed in another example of the Very Rare Union frame, Branches of Leaves and Flowers [7-12] (some nicking, losses to verso, missing hardware). -- And 7 other framed images including 4 daguerreotypes including 4 daguerreotypes and 3 ambrotypes, ranging in size from half plate to ninth plate. One may be a modern ambrotype. Conditions vary. -- Together, 10 assorted portraits housed in frames.
